    From Wiki:

    "...Fixx was genetically predisposed (his father died of a heart attack aged 43 and Fixx himself had a congenitally enlarged heart) and several lifestyle issues (Fixx was a heavy smoker prior to beginning running aged 36, he had a stressful occupation, he had undergone a second divorce, and his weight before he took up running had ballooned to 220lbs)."

    I think it was mostly genetic predisposition and being a heavy smoker for who knows how many years. The other factors were contributing and secondary.
